Agreed. I have had all features of Apple music and Beats 1 on iTunes for
windows since the release date on June 30. Also, I use the F6 key to navigate
around iTunes, between different parts of the screen. This enables me to access
playlists, songs, albums and play controls

Hi
Yes it can be done, the update has been out a week. What I do is press F6
until I see the player controls such as volume etc. Being this is a live
radio station you can only play or stop the stream, not fast forward or
rewind it.

Hello,



Thought some of you may wish to know that though apple music said that on
the launch day it'd be available on windows and the website was advertising
it as being so, it was not the case. However, bnow if you have the latest
version of itunes it is there.



I haven't really explored it much, though have managed to launch the beats 1
station successfully.



This may not be most intuitive so here's how it's done: when launching
itunes, shift tab till you find a bunch of radio buttons and keep shift
tabbing till you get to "radio" radio button. Press enter on that. Itunes
store will open. Just hit "listen now" button. There doesn't seem to be easy
way of controls such as volume, pause, rewind etc., or perhaps I just
haven't noticed it since I just recently plaied with this, but at least for
those who do not have IOS or prefer to listen on windows, it can be done.
